Its not the HP its the torque. 400tq (as was already stated) tends to be the most you want to push and still keep it reasonably reliable. When I had a 6spd I ran it around at close to 400 lbs-ft for a few years and its was fine, still shifted great.

You can make more power, you need a bigger turbo. If you hold 400wtq flat to redline it'll make about 525-550whp up top. I wouldn't push the 6 speed much past 400wtq. It just makes more heat, and heat brakes stuff. Especially with the way the shafts flex in the 6 speed. It's great some people get away with it, but it's not recommended.

i think it has more to do with how you drive it than how much power. the 6 speeds are prone to overheating so if you drive it around town and do a few blasts down the road or drag strip now and then, its probably gonna take a ton of power but if you wanna be ricky bobby or stig jr, youre gonna need a cooler or a 5 speed.
theres a thread somewhere here where the gears were measured on the 5 and 6 speed to compare them, and the 6 speed's 1st and 2nd were actually wider than the 5 speed ones. just keep the trans temp under control and its going to live a lot longer.
